Patricia Mary Stipsky

Patricia Mary (Rickert) Stipsky was born at the Methodist hospital in downtown Los Angeles, California in 1937 and passed away at Kingman Regional Medical Center on February 12, 2024. She was 86 years old. Patricia (Pat) liked to deny that she was born in Kingman since her parents, Val and Hazel Rickert, traveled to Los Angeles for the birth of their only child, returning after two weeks. She grew up at the Wal-A-Pai Court on Route 66 (Front Street) and graduated from Mohave County Union High School in 1955. In fact, Pat lived her entire life in Kingman with the…

Zeke Mesa

Zeke Mesa, a lifelong resident of Kingman Arizona passed away at home surrounded by loved ones on February 2, 2024 at the age of 79 Zeke was born August 27, 1944 in Kingman.  He graduated from Mohave County Union High School in 1963.  He attended college in Yuma, Arizona before returning to Kingman to work at Alex Toggery, Duval Mine, the Elks Lodge and finally for the school district. Sports were a very big part of Zeke’s life He was known in the community for coaching and umpiring from little league to AA games, where he umped three national tournaments….

Elaine Anne Byrnes

March 13, 1943 – May 31, 2023 Elaine Anne Byrnes passed away on May 31, 2023, at a Hospice house in Tucson. Elaine was born on March 13, 1943 in Boston, Massachusetts to Samuel and Anna (O’Shea) Cooke. In June 1961 Elaine married her soulmate, John Byrnes. Together, they raised a familyand relocated to Lake Havasu in 1976.  Elaine volunteered at her children’s elementary schools, Starline and Oro Grande and eventually built a career at the Lake Havasu Board of Realtors. Upon retirement, she volunteered at the Lake Havasu City Visitor Center. In 2020, she moved to Tucson to be closer to family. Elaine was a loving wife, and a dearmother to her five children. She was also a proud“Grammy/Gigi” to ten…
